news 2026/6/2 21:38:18

LeaguePrank技术解析:英雄联盟段位自定义工具深度剖析

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
LeaguePrank技术解析:英雄联盟段位自定义工具深度剖析

LeaguePrank技术解析:英雄联盟段位自定义工具深度剖析

【免费下载链接】LeaguePrank项目地址: https://gitcode.com/gh_mirrors/le/LeaguePrank

LeaguePrank作为一款专业的英雄联盟客户端段位信息修改工具,通过技术创新实现了游戏界面显示的个性化定制。本文将从技术架构、实现原理到实际应用,全面解析这款工具的核心价值。

技术架构与实现原理

多模块协同架构设计

LeaguePrank采用分层架构设计,各模块职责清晰明确。核心组件包括:

前端渲染层:基于HTML5和CSS3构建的用户界面,采用响应式设计确保在不同分辨率下的显示效果。view/css目录下的样式文件提供了完整的视觉主题支持,其中style.min.css作为核心样式文件,定义了段位展示的视觉规范。

数据通信层:通过view/js/LCUconnect.js脚本建立与英雄联盟客户端的连接通道,实现了实时数据交换和状态同步。

应用逻辑层:C++编写的核心业务逻辑,处理数据解析、状态管理和界面控制等关键功能。

客户端连接机制

工具通过分析英雄联盟客户端的Lockfile文件获取连接凭据,建立与LCU(League Client Update)API的安全通信链路。这种设计确保了工具与游戏客户端的无缝集成,同时保证了操作的稳定性和可靠性。

功能特性详解

段位信息自定义

LeaguePrank支持全方位的段位信息定制功能:

  • 段位等级调整:从黑铁到王者,任意段位均可设置
  • 胜率数据配置:自定义胜场、负场和胜率百分比
  • 排名数据展示:设置具体的排名位置和区域信息

工具界面采用现代化设计,提供直观的操作体验

生涯数据个性化

除了基础的段位信息,工具还支持更深层次的个性化定制:

  • 常用英雄配置:自定义展示的英雄池和熟练度
  • 历史战绩编辑:调整历史对局记录和表现数据
  • 荣誉系统定制:修改荣誉等级和获得的徽章信息

环境配置与部署指南

系统环境要求

成功部署LeaguePrank需要满足以下环境条件:

  • Qt框架5.12及以上版本
  • C++17标准兼容的编译器
  • Windows 10或更高版本操作系统
  • 正在运行的英雄联盟游戏客户端

项目构建流程

获取项目源代码:

git clone https://gitcode.com/gh_mirrors/le/LeaguePrank

构建步骤:

  1. 配置Qt开发环境
  2. 解析项目依赖关系
  3. 编译核心组件
  4. 打包发布版本

核心技术实现

数据拦截与重写机制

LeaguePrank通过Hook技术拦截客户端的数据请求,在数据返回给渲染层之前进行修改。这种实现方式确保了修改的实时性和准确性。

安全通信协议

工具采用加密通信协议与游戏客户端交互,确保数据传输的安全性和完整性。同时,通过合理的错误处理机制,避免了因连接异常导致的客户端崩溃问题。

工具采用先进的技术架构,确保稳定运行

应用场景与价值分析

个性化展示需求

LeaguePrank主要满足以下应用场景:

  • 内容创作者制作特色视频素材
  • 玩家个性化社交展示
  • 技术爱好者学习研究

技术研究价值

作为一款开源工具,LeaguePrank具有重要的技术研究价值:

  • 客户端逆向工程案例研究
  • 游戏数据协议分析参考
  • 界面定制技术实践范例

使用规范与注意事项

合规使用原则

为确保工具的合理使用,建议遵循以下原则:

  • 仅限于娱乐和个人展示用途
  • 不得用于误导他人或虚假宣传
  • 尊重游戏开发者的知识产权

技术风险防范

在使用过程中需要注意以下技术风险:

  • 游戏版本更新可能导致兼容性问题
  • 系统安全软件可能误判为风险程序
  • 不当使用可能违反游戏服务条款

技术发展趋势

功能扩展方向

未来版本可能增加的功能特性:

  • 更多游戏数据的自定义选项
  • 界面主题的深度定制支持
  • 跨平台兼容性优化

技术优化空间

现有架构存在的优化可能性:

  • 性能提升和资源占用优化
  • 用户体验改进和交互设计优化
  • 代码质量和可维护性提升

通过本文的技术解析,相信读者对LeaguePrank有了更深入的理解。这款工具不仅提供了实用的功能,更展现了现代软件开发的技术魅力。

【免费下载链接】LeaguePrank项目地址: https://gitcode.com/gh_mirrors/le/LeaguePrank

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/29 22:20:35

五款热门翻译模型横向评测:响应速度与资源占用排名

五款热门翻译模型横向评测:响应速度与资源占用排名 📊 评测背景与目标 随着全球化进程加速,高质量的中英翻译需求日益增长。在 AI 驱动的自然语言处理领域,神经网络机器翻译(NMT)已成为主流技术方案。然而&…

作者头像 李华
网站建设 2026/6/2 20:05:28

MusicFree插件终极指南:打造你的专属音乐宇宙

MusicFree插件终极指南:打造你的专属音乐宇宙 【免费下载链接】MusicFreePlugins MusicFree播放插件 项目地址: https://gitcode.com/gh_mirrors/mu/MusicFreePlugins 在数字音乐时代,MusicFree插件系统为用户提供了一个全新的音乐体验方式。通过…

作者头像 李华
网站建设 2026/5/30 17:09:22

IDEA摸鱼阅读神器Thief-Book终极指南:代码间隙的隐秘阅读空间

IDEA摸鱼阅读神器Thief-Book终极指南:代码间隙的隐秘阅读空间 【免费下载链接】thief-book-idea IDEA插件版上班摸鱼看书神器 项目地址: https://gitcode.com/gh_mirrors/th/thief-book-idea 在紧张的编程工作中,每个开发者都需要短暂的休息来调整…

作者头像 李华
网站建设 2026/5/31 21:44:45

联想拯救者工具箱性能优化指南:解决笔记本卡顿与续航问题

联想拯救者工具箱性能优化指南:解决笔记本卡顿与续航问题 【免费下载链接】LenovoLegionToolkit Lightweight Lenovo Vantage and Hotkeys replacement for Lenovo Legion laptops. 项目地址: https://gitcode.com/gh_mirrors/le/LenovoLegionToolkit 还在为…

作者头像 李华
网站建设 2026/5/30 17:50:52

百度网盘直链下载终极指南:三步实现满速下载体验

百度网盘直链下载终极指南:三步实现满速下载体验 【免费下载链接】baiduyun 油猴脚本 - 一个免费开源的网盘下载助手 项目地址: https://gitcode.com/gh_mirrors/ba/baiduyun 还在为百度网盘龟速下载而苦恼吗?网盘直链下载助手为你提供完美的解决…

作者头像 李华
网站建设 2026/5/30 18:40:46

DOL汉化美化整合包:终极完整安装与使用指南

DOL汉化美化整合包:终极完整安装与使用指南 【免费下载链接】DOL-CHS-MODS Degrees of Lewdity 整合 项目地址: https://gitcode.com/gh_mirrors/do/DOL-CHS-MODS 想要快速体验DOL汉化美化整合包的强大功能吗?这个一站式解决方案为您带来了高质量…

作者头像 李华